Older Adult Self‐Harm: A Descriptive Study

Self‐harm is a public health problem and is associated with higher suicidal intent and greater suicidal risk in older adults. This retrospective cross‐sectional study examines psychosocial characteristics, service provision and outcomes in patients attending a mental health liaison service (MHLS) with self‐harm attempt in Lincolnshire. The authors also investigate demographic, psychiatric and clinical factors related to self‐harm and discharge destination.
